Webb13 juli 2024 · Animal-assisted therapy (AAT) is a therapy technique that involves an animal and can be in an individual or group setting. The type of animal recommended is typically advised by a veterinarian behaviorist or animal behaviorist. A therapy animal such as a dog must be in good physical health and treated properly by its owner. WebbTo be eligible to volunteer as a therapy dog evaluator, applicants must: Have a documented minimum of 100 hours of experience as a therapy or facility dog handler. Obtain and maintain active status as an AKC Canine Good Citizen (CGC)® Approved Evaluator. Be familiar with therapy or facility dog settings.
